Error Reduction of Sliding Mode Control Using Sigmoid-Type Nonlinear Interpolation in the Boundary Layer

  • Kim, Yoo-K.;Jeon, Gi-J.
    • 제어로봇시스템학회:학술대회논문집
    • /
    • 2003.10a
    • /
    • pp.1810-1815
    • /
    • 2003
  • Sliding mode control with nonlinear interpolation in the boundary layer is proposed. A modified sigmoid function is used for nonlinear interpolation in the boundary layer and its parameter is tuned by a fuzzy logic controller. The fuzzy logic controller that takes the distance between the system state and the sliding surface as its input guides the choice of parameter of the modified sigmoid function and the parameter is on-line tuned. Owing to the decreased thickness, the proposed method has better tracking performance than the conventional linear interpolation method. To demonstrate its performance, the proposed control algorithm is applied to a simple nonlinear system model.

An image coding algorithm using fractal interpolation method (이산 트랙탈 보간법을 이용한 영상 부호화 알고리즘)

  • 이승현;정현민;윤택현;최일상;박규태
    • Journal of the Korean Institute of Telematics and Electronics B
    • /
    • v.33B no.6
    • /
    • pp.82-91
    • /
    • 1996
  • In this paper, an image coding technique using fractal interpolation is proposed. Similar to the conventional methods, an image is partitioned into blocks and each block is coded independently. However, an interpolation point is ahsared by its neighboring blocks. This means that each block can use all its interpolation points with minimal increase of new data. For a simple implementation, triangular blocks are used instead of square blocks and new coefficients are difined. Data obtained in the encoding process hav estatistical characteristics suitable sfor entropy coding, an dthus arithmetic coding is perfomred for improving the compression efficiency. The results of the proposed coder in comparison with those of a conventional coder show that the interpolation method reduces block effect caused by a memoryless block coder, especially at low bit rates. This improvement is due to sharing of information between adjacent blocks. Moreover, th enumber of iteration required in ecoding process is reduced since more information is used to decode each block.

Interpolation Error Compensation Method for PMSM Torque Control (PMSM 토크제어를 위한 보간오차 보상방법)

  • Lee, Jung-Hyo
    • The Transactions of The Korean Institute of Electrical Engineers
    • /
    • v.67 no.3
    • /
    • pp.391-397
    • /
    • 2018
  • This paper proposes a interpolation error compensation method for PMSM torque control. In PMSM torque control, two dimensions look-up table(2D-LUT) is used for current reference generation due to its stable and robust torque control performance. However, the stored data in 2D-LUT is discreet, it is impossible to store all over the operation range. To reduce the reference generation error in this region, the 2D-Interpolation method is conventionally used, however, this method still remains the error affected by the number of stored data. Besides, in the case stored by fixed unit, this error is increased in field weakening region because of the small number of stored data. In this paper, analyzing the cause of this interpolation error, and compensating the method to reduce this error. Proposed method is verified by the simulation and experiment.

Boundary Strength based Adaptive Interpolation Filter (경계 강도 기반의 적응적 보간 필터)

  • Song, Yunseok;Choi, Jung-Ah;Ho, Yo-Sung
    • Proceedings of the Korean Society of Broadcast Engineers Conference
    • /
    • 2014.06a
    • /
    • pp.26-27
    • /
    • 2014
  • This paper presents an adaptive interpolation filtering scheme for the High Efficiency Video Coding (HEVC) standard. In regards to interpolation for motion estimation and compensation, the conventional HEVC employs 8-tap and 4-tap filters for luma and chroma samples, respectively. Coefficients in such filters are determined by discrete cosine transform (DCT). In the proposed scheme, boundary strength values are stored after the execution of the deblocking filter. For each block, the sum of boundary strength values is calculated to indicate whether its region is complex or simple. Consequently, based on the region classification, 12-tap and 8-tap interpolation filters are used for complex and simple regions, respectively. This process is applied to luma sample interpolation only. Simulation results show 1.8% average BD-rate reduction compared to the conventional method.

Intelligent interpolation methods for a full-scale SPOT-DEM

  • Kim, Seung-Bum;Park, Won-Kyu;Kim, Tag-Gon
    • Proceedings of the KSRS Conference
    • /
    • 1999.11a
    • /
    • pp.171-176
    • /
    • 1999
  • Intelligent schemes for an automatic generation of DEM (digital elevation model) are implemented. The need for these post-processing schemes is that interpolation alone produces severe blunders, however sophisticated it is. These blunders occur most seriously along the boundaries of a scene, over rivers, and along the coast. Even a state-of-the-art commercial software retains such blunders. The intelligent schemes implemented are (1) center-of-gravity and empty-center-index which quantify how evenly distributed interpolants are within in interpolation radius. (2) a segmentation scheme to discern whether or not an empty segment in stereo-match results should be interpolated, and (3) a segmentation scheme for removing noise-like features, with these methods, in the final DEM, identical coastline and river region to those in the original SPOT scenes are achieved. The DEM exhibits substantial improvements over the products of an existing commercial software.

Construction of curve-net interpolation surface considering trajectory of cross-section curves (단면곡선의 궤적을 고려한 곡선망 보간곡면 형성)

  • Yoo, Woo-Sik;Shin, Ha-Yong;Choi, Byoung-K.
    • Journal of Korean Institute of Industrial Engineers
    • /
    • v.20 no.2
    • /
    • pp.77-90
    • /
    • 1994
  • Curve-net interpolation surface is one of the most popular method in engineering design. Therefore it is supported with many commercial CAD/CAM system. However, construction algorithm of curve-net interpolation surfaces is rarely opened to the public because of its copy-right. In this paper we establish a construction algorithm of curve-net interpolation surface so called sweeping surface which especially concentrates on trajectory of cross-section curve. We also show the method which can construct sweeping surfaces as NURB or Bezier mathematical models. Surfaces having the form of standard mathematical models are very useful for the application of joining, trimming, blending etc. The proposed surface interpolation scheme consists of four steps; (1) preparation of guide curves and section curves, (2) remeshing guide curves and section curves, (3) blending section curves after deformation, and (4) determination of control points for sweeping surface using gordon method. The proposed method guarantee $G^1$-continuety, and construct the surface salifying given section curves and trajectory of section curves.

N- gram Adaptation Using Information Retrieval and Dynamic Interpolation Coefficient (정보검색 기법과 동적 보간 계수를 이용한 N-gram 언어모델의 적응)

  • Choi Joon Ki;Oh Yung-Hwan
    • MALSORI
    • /
    • no.56
    • /
    • pp.207-223
    • /
    • 2005
  • The goal of language model adaptation is to improve the background language model with a relatively small adaptation corpus. This study presents a language model adaptation technique where additional text data for the adaptation do not exist. We propose the information retrieval (IR) technique with N-gram language modeling to collect the adaptation corpus from baseline text data. We also propose to use a dynamic language model interpolation coefficient to combine the background language model and the adapted language model. The interpolation coefficient is estimated from the word hypotheses obtained by segmenting the input speech data reserved for held-out validation data. This allows the final adapted model to improve the performance of the background model consistently The proposed approach reduces the word error rate by $13.6\%$ relative to baseline 4-gram for two-hour broadcast news speech recognition.
